I always find it fascinating how God gives you the right message from his word when you need it. As I checked my phone after the workout, the daily verse notification had hit my phone.

Psalms 121:1-2
1 I lift up my eyes to the hills. From where does my help come? 2 My help comes from the Lord, who made heaven and earth.

Seemed ironic after a hill-themed workout that this verse with a message to lift our eyes to the hills would appear on my phone. It made be think of all the struggle, pain, hurt, and strife in our world right now, but through it all, God offers help, hope, and love. It’s up to us as a group of men to be leaders and spread that same love to our families, our friends, and our community. I think back to the sights we saw on the Mortimer of God’s creation. The same God that made those hills and mountains will provide a way for us to get through the hills and mountains in our own life. Just know that we are never alone, and I’m thankful to have you men as friends that lift me up and hold me accountable.

Grief?

We had a good turnout at the Sword this morning, most ran, a couple rucked! We all circled up for some scripture at 6!
2 Corinthians 7:10 For godly grief produces a repentance that leads to salvation without regret, whereas worldly grief produces death.

grief- deep sorrow

Worldly grief produces death!
it’s when someone is sad or deeply sorrowful over consequences, most of the time with no true intentions of repentance, although Hebrews 12:17 speaks of says “Esau found no chance of repentance, though he sought it with tears”.

Godly grief produces a repentance that leads to salvation!
It produces a true change of heart and mind! Away from evil and towards God! A great example of godly grief is Psalm 51, where David is completely broken over his sin and turns to God to cleanse him and restore him!

Isaiah 55:6 “Seek the Lord while he may be found; call upon him while he is near.”

Sprint, Mosey & Sharknado at The Yank

If the local weather men and women were correct we were in for a whole lot of rain Friday night and right through the day on Saturday.  But they weren’t as usual so I changed up my game plan the night before for nothing.  Either way 16 men spent the morning with me at the Fighting Yank doing a little more running than they wanted to.  Here is how it went…

Mosey to Two Chicks parking lot for some warm up.

SSH x 15, Grass Pickers x 15, IST x 15, Moroccan Night Club x 15, Stretch – to your toes, to your left foot and then to your right foot.  Then 5 burpees just because.

Line up & Indian run around the block to end up behind Sammy’s

Break up into three lines of sprinters.  Time for some sprints.  100 yard dash & Mosey back to start.  All three lines down and back for 1 minute of Mtn. Climbers.  Line up & Repeato 9X substituting Mtn Climbers for Jump Squats, Merkins, Flutter Kicks, Freddie Mercury, CDDs, LBCs and more.  In round two we lost our brother Pilgrim’s Progress to his nagging hamstring injury.  He was in sprint mode when his leg said that was enough.  Sorry again about the sprints brother.  With the 100s behind us I checked my watch and called an audible to forget about running the 50s.  Lets not have any more injuries.

Next on the weinke , a mosey to the park bathrooms to grab some wall and catch our breath.  People’s chair with some air presses, right leg up, left leg up.  Recover and we are off to the new park pavilion.  Because it was supposed to be raining…remember.

In observance of Shark Week we partnered up for a Sharknado around the fountain.  Partner one starts the run to the fountain, takes three laps around and returns to pavilion while partner two begins 100 merkins, 200 LBC and 300 squats.  Switch until all 600 are complete.

Circle up back under the pavilion for some Jack Webbs x (audible) 8, followed by flutter kicks, LBC, and 5 burpees called by Boudin.

Final mosey to The Fighting Yank statue for the Pledge, Name o rama and prayer lead by TopHat.

Today we prayed for safe travels for Tesla’s son headed to DC. ALL of the school teachers, administrators, students of all ages, and parents too.  Our brothers newly injured and those on IR.  First Responders and the health of our great nation.
